你查询的IP:[120.24.36.59]  地理位置:中国–广东–深圳阿里云BGP数据中心(BGP)

最新查询121.255.50.90 123.103.215.215 120.64.246.229 124.20.60.236 122.48.50.216 220.154.86.113 218.249.6.12 218.108.84.43 222.176.6.192 120.24.36.59 116.204.131.177 210.12.36.245 120.80.184.117 121.46.110.166 118.120.224.214 203.174.7.119 202.4.128.217 119.42.75.44 203.152.64.146 116.90.184.145 123.98.245.194 218.104.148.93 114.28.104.29 202.38.150.69 116.204.195.201 203.158.16.103 222.32.245.63 120.137.188.106 119.42.136.71 218.64.69.28 202.4.252.235